1964 Governor General's Awards

Each winner of the 1964 Governor General's Awards for Literary Merit was selected by a panel of judges administered by the Canada Council for the Arts.

Winners

English Language

*Fiction: Douglas LePan, "The Deserter".
*Poetry or Drama: Raymond Souster, "The Colour of the Times".
*Non-Fiction: Phyllis Grosskurth, "John Addington Symonds".

French Language

*Fiction: Jean-Paul Pinsonneault, "Les terres sèches".
*Poetry or Drama: Pierre Perrault, "Au coeur de la rose".
*Non-Fiction: Réjean Robidoux, "Roger Martin du Gard et la religion".
